          Borut_Z — 19 years ago(June 03, 2006 04:12 PM)

          It was a feel good movie, I agree with you on that, but I don't know why is that a problem? Especially because the movie didn't come across as corny. Which would easily happen considering the theme.
          Also, I don't know why would you dismiss the movie just because Lopez is in it. That doesn't make it automatically bad. I think she did a good job. Probably her best performance, but I realize that doesn't say much since her other performances range between very bad and mediocre.
          I found the script very clever. It was a slow-paced movie, but just before the point of boredom something happened. Maybe it was predictable, but focusing on outside events is missing the point. The movie was about inside worlds of characters. That's where major things happened.
          I can agree that nothing really stood out, but take a look at Top 250 Movies; it's full of movies that don't really stand out.
